A Ministry of Education official has been demoted and received two major demerits after he allegedly sent several sexual messages to a female staff member at a university.

The case involved a section chief surnamed Tsai (蔡), who allegedly pursued a university student surnamed Huang (黃), who was working as an office assistant for a professor.

An internal ministry report said that Tsai became acquainted with Huang through his work for the ministry with universities.

He allegedly sent repeated messages through the Line messaging app asking Huang out for a date “to make love,” the report said.    [FULL  STORY]
